Ah, come on.

In his 244 game career he hasn’t played 1 in the championship. Premier league the whole time.

Also in his 15 games this season he’s Scored 4 and assisted 3. I’d say before his injury he was playing well. You may notice after his injury we went from a pretty poor outfit and changed into an absolutely awful one.

Yes, he’s not got a lot of pace. But he works incredibly hard and has a wand of a left foot.

Is he the future of the starting 11 if we want to push for European places? Probably not. We’re not anywhere near there right now. We’re just trying to stay in the league.

But as someone to bring on as a different option when the opposition is tired? I’d argue he’d play his part.
